** Changed in: network-manager (Ubuntu) Status: Incomplete => Expired -- You received this bug notification because you are a member of Desktop Packages, which is subscribed to network-manager in Ubuntu. https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/654446 Title: resolv.conf not updated with new address when client lease renewed and server dhcp option 6 (dns server) has changed Status in “network-manager” package in Ubuntu: Expired Bug description: Binary package hint: network-manager Steps to reproduce: 1. Obtain lease, observe nameserver address in /etc/resolv.conf. 2. Change dns server address provided by dhcp server in dhcp option 6 to clients 3. Wait until release renew occurs. 4. Observe that /etc/resolv.conf has not been updated with the new value for dns server. 5. Manually disable and enable connection using network manager. 6. Observer that /etc/resolv.conf has been updated by network manager. Notes: it is useful to set a relatively short lease time, 5-10 minutes, and to capture packets on the connection.
